Breakdown at Kashagan will not influence reaching commercial production

The Minister of Oil and Gas of Kazakhstan U. Karabalin says that the postponement in oil production at Kashagan will not influence it reaching commercial production, i.e. 75,000 barrels, planned for October 2013. Production was postponed on September 25 for 3-4 days due to breakdown at the pipeline. Oil production at Kashagan began on September 11th 2013. Those who participate in the project are Kazmunai Gas, Eni, ExxonMobil, Royal Dutch Shell, Total and Inpex. KMG bought 8.33% in the project from CNPC.
